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
93376102816 3807309224 662 83741657 992651
641745 87182
641745 87182
60 9354 49 8665 408916472
All about undefined
Interested in learning more?
641745 87182
60 9354 49 8665 408916472
See more
377 292
087 8984 15655230
See more
44418 56508
268781577 335 53576 79092801944 59822
See more